Better without Pete
rmmil16 March 2022
Even though it wasn't the best, this show is still way better without Pete Davidson. His inability to read cue cards and do live comedy is why he should have left the show years ago. Go do your terrible films and leave this show alone. The 3-4 episodes without him have been way better than the ones with.

As usual the cold opener was a dud. They should stop trying to do comedy about serious topics, they obviously can't navigate it.

The Kate / Aidy "nerd kid" skit is a repeater that was never funny, I don't know why they keep doing it. However, there were some funny parts to the show overall.

The Alex Moffat "LSD" film reviewer is always very funny, and Weekend Update as a whole was good.

Zoe Kravitz seemed to have a hard time with cue cards herself, but I thought she had good comedic timing overall.

It was decent, I hope Pete stays away.
